2017-12-31 152 views
-2

私はPythonでこのコードを使用しています:Webdriver.get(URL)オープンFirefoxのではなく、URL

from selenium import webdriver 
from selenium.webdriver.firefox.firefox_binary import FirefoxBinary 

binary = FirefoxBinary(r'C:\Program Files (x86)\Mozilla Firefox\firefox.exe') 
driver = webdriver.Firefox(firefox_binary=binary) 
driver.get("www.google.com") 

アンラッキー、このオープンFirefoxのではなく、URL(任意のエラーを返しません)。 あなたはその理由を知っていますか?

+0

このドライバを試してみてください.get( "https://www.googl e.com ") –

+0

do not work :(.. – omersk

+0

何かエラーが表示されていますか? –

答えて

0

あなたが最近Frirefox QuantumブラウザとともにSelenium 3.xを使用している場合は、引数executable_pathを通じてgeckodriverバイナリの絶対的な場所を、それはあなたのシステムにthis location場所からgeckodriver.exeをダウンロードして言及する必要がありは次のようになります。

from selenium import webdriver 

driver = webdriver.Firefox(executable_path=r'C:\Utility\BrowserDrivers\geckodriver.exe') 
driver.get('https://www.google.co.in') 
print("Page Title is : %s" %driver.title) 
driver.quit() 
関連する問題